A program that provides assistance for basic needs such as rent, food, non-food, medication, fuel, utilities and other essential services.

What is General Assistance?

100

A household-level economic and social condition of limited or uncertain access to adequate food

What is Food Insecurity?

Often mistaken for hunger, which is an individual physiological condition of needing to eat

The overall trend in poverty percentages in Maine since 2016

(Decreasing, Increasing, or Staying the Same)

What is decreasing?

Poverty percentages have dropped from 14.7% in 2012 to 10.8% in 2022

The number of household members for to meet the United States poverty guideline in 2023 with an income of $30,000



What is 4?

A single adult meets the poverty guideline at just $14,580, which is far below the cost of living in Greater Portland.

This age group has the highest estimated percentage of people living in poverty in Maine, at 19.10%

Children under 5

Children 5-17

Adults 18-64

Adults over 65


What is Children under 5?

This is actually a relatively small percent of the total state population living in poverty, but nearly 1 in 5 Maine toddlers are living in poverty
